    My quote for that $5 a month was for all access on the radio as well as other device, such as SiriusXM on Roku. However I actually tried looking at SiriusXM on Roku, and it is only a radio signal and not video, so I pretty much thought that was worthless. But so many people on here get the same offer of $5 a month, so I would hold out for that. I STILL get snailmails from them offering me that deal. It all depends on how much you drive your vehicle, WHERE you drive it, and if it is worth it to you, which is a highly subjective thing, to pay ANYTHING for satellite radio. If I was a truck driver, I would very much think it was worth it because the signal is pretty much constant, unlike local FM stations which usually last about an hour or so if you are traveling, before you run out of range. But for me, I only drive locally, and very rarely even turn on the radio, so it wasn't worth paying anything, to me. Now, I have a neighbor, who loves country music, but there are no country music stations around here, so he pays for Sirius because it has several country channels, so for him, it is worth it. As I said, it is a highly subjective thing as to whether paying ANYTHING for satellite is worth it, and then, How Much.
